Mumbai, July 23: Government has decided not to challenge the Kerala High Court order asking Air India to give proper compensation to the next of kin of the victims of Mangalore air crash which claimed 158 lives. Padubidri, July 23: A college student lost his life after he accidentally drowned in a lake in Yellur area near here on Friday. The deceased has been identified as Harshith Sunder, aged 20 years, studying in final year B Com at Vijaya College in Mulki.
